Definition

Usually, it is a thing that includes a processor, memory, input/output (I/O) on a single chip. They are found everywhere. We can say it as a processor. Different applications have different kinds of a processor which is nothing but microcontroller.

Ex. In our computer, we have one processor. Which is the main unit of the overall system? No of companies who designs these kinds of processors. There are microcontrollers differentiated by 4 bit, 8 bit, 16 bit, 32 bit, 64 bit, etc.

They are programmed in a way that it performs human tasks very easily. It’s programmed to work as per situations. i.e. instructions are written for that.

Understanding Microcontrollers

They are mainly used in embedded systems. If you know embedded systems like a washing machine, telephone, PSP, etc. These are a small dedicated system that does not require a lot of computing. Here they are useful.

They are based on two types.

1. Complex Instruction Set Computing (CISC) :

It has a large no of instructions. A larger instruction set helps the programmer to write effective and short programs. The main aim of CISC is to write few lines of code in machine language.

2. Reduced Instruction Set Computing (RISC):

RISC requires less hardware implementation because of fewer instructions. A popular example of this is the PIC family of microcontrollers by Microchip.
However, the more important thing is, How fast the chip can execute its instructions and how it runs particular software.

Difference between Microprocessor and Microcontroller

The difference between Microprocessor and Microcontroller are as explained.

Microprocessor

Microcontroller

This is a chip that does not have its internal memory, I/O, ROM with it. We have to externally attach it with the processor. It is integrated with its RAM, ROM, I/O within it.
It’s a big system and needs more peripherals to work. You can use this single chip, and you can ready to implement the task.
It has one or two-bit handling instructions It has many bits handling instructions
Microprocessor systems are more flexible from the design point of view. These systems are less flexible from a design point of view
It has a single memory map for data and code It has a separate memory map for data and code.

Working with Microcontroller

Initially, we need to write a program for the controller. From ancient times, we are doing it by assembly language. Which we also called machine level language. A binary format that the computer understands. Nowadays, the C language, python, is also used. They are built to work on a small level. The embedded system has these microcontrollers. Embedded means all the features are combined in a single unit. Microcontrollers got very advanced. These also support wifi, Ethernet, etc.

Why should we use a Microcontroller?

As I mentioned earlier, it works as the brain of the system. It contains all in one chip like memory, processor, I/O, counter, timer. It is an embedded unit programmed for a specific task to be done as per requirement.

We can say that it is a microprocessor with some extra advantages. When any device needs to communicate and has to make some decisions on its own, at that time, it comes into the picture. It gives intelligence to that device to work as per instructions was written on it.
